Learn keyfacts about OTHM Level 3 Foundation Diploma Health Social Care
The OTHM Level 3 Foundation Diploma in Health and Social Care is a popular and industry-relevant qualification that provides learners with a solid foundation in the principles and practices of health and social care.
Learning outcomes of the diploma include understanding the role of health and social care professionals, the importance of health promotion and disease prevention, and the delivery of person-centered care. Learners will also develop skills in communication, teamwork, and leadership, as well as an understanding of the social and economic factors that influence health and wellbeing.
The duration of the diploma is typically 12-16 weeks, with learners completing a series of assignments and assessments that are designed to test their knowledge and understanding of the subject matter. The qualification is assessed through a combination of written assignments, case studies, and a final project.
The OTHM Level 3 Foundation Diploma in Health and Social Care is highly relevant to the healthcare and social care industries, with many employers requiring or preferring candidates to hold this qualification. The diploma is also a great stepping stone for those looking to progress to higher-level qualifications, such as the OTHM Level 4 Diploma in Health and Social Care.
Industry relevance is a key aspect of the diploma, with learners developing skills and knowledge that are highly valued by employers. The qualification is designed to prepare learners for a range of roles in health and social care, including care worker, health assistant, and social care support worker.
